Colorado Springs police search for missing 12-year-old boy


COLORADO SPRINGS, Colo. (KKTV) –

UPDATE: Javonte Hayes has been safely located, according to CSPD.

Police are searching for a missing child who was last seen at his home on the southeast part of the city.

They said 12-year-old Javonte Hayes was last seen at 6 p.m. on Sunday on Morley drive. That’s near South Academy and Astrozon.

Colorado community college receives grant to support those not yet in school, or still seeking employment


The Community College of Aurora just got a big chuck of change to help young people who are not in school or working to reconnect with education and career opportunities. They hope it can help close what youth advocates call “the opportunity gap.”

CBS

Advertisement


There are lots of reasons people won’t seek education after high school.

“Some may not see it as a good investment at the time. Honestly, we also compete with the gig economy. Right? You see the money in your pocket immediately, and you think, ‘This is great money,’” said Clair Collins the vice president of Enrollment Success and Completion at the college. 

That kind of experience described by Collins is among many reasons college students don’t finish their degrees.

“Maybe, they have a family member that they’re the primary caretaker of,” Collins said. “Maybe, they feel that they cannot currently invest the time or money into going and pursuing a college education. Maybe, they’re a parent.”

But thanks to a new $100,000 grant from Aspen Institute Forum for Community Solutions, the Community College of Aurora hopes to enable those people to invest in their future.

Advertisement

“What we see over time is that return on investment is better if students go to college,” Collins said.

The college plans on using the money to work with other organizations to reach out to young people to see why they aren’t going to college, then provide them resources and services they need.

“Also investing in some proactive system redesign so that students don’t have to self-identify as needing this help in the first place,” Collins said. “That they can just come to us and expect that their needs are going to be met.”

CCA says this will not only benefit the students they can help and the college, but also the state.

“Colorado is well poised to be a true economic engine, for the United States, and CCA wants to be a big part of that,” Collins said.

What channel is Louisville vs Colorado on today? UofL WBB game time, TV schedule


play

No. 21 Louisville women’s basketball has one more game before jumping into ACC action, facing Colorado tonight at the KFC Yum! Center.

The programs have only played three times before, with U of L winning the last two games. Last year, Taj Roberts scored 13 points in the Cards’ 79-71 road win over the Buffaloes. The sophomore comes into this year’s game after tying her career high with 23 points in a dominating win over Northern Kentucky.

Advertisement

She’ll have help from forward Laura Ziegler, who is averaging a double-double in her first two games as a Cardinal. The Saint Joseph’s transfer had nine points, 11 rebounds and five assists with only one foul against NKU.

Can’t make it to the KFC Yum! Center? Here’s what you need to know to follow tonight’s game from home:

The Cardinals and Buffaloes are scheduled to tip off at 7 p.m. today.

The game will not be on national television but will be streamed on ACCNx.

Advertisement

If you subscribe to a cable package, you’ll be able to livestream the game via ESPN.com and the ESPN app. If you don’t have cable, you can livestream the game via ESPN+ (subscriber only) or Fubo, which offers a free trial here.

Nick Curran (play-by-play) and Cortnee Walton (analyst) will have the call on the Cardinal Sports Network (WLCL 93.9-FM and WGTK 970-AM in Louisville).

You can also listen online via GoCards.com.

Rain Enhancement Tech (NASDAQ: RAIN) starts U.S. WETA in CO, first warm weather program









Rain Enhancement Technologies (NASDAQ:RAIN) began operations of its first U.S. Weather Enhancement Technology Array (WETA) in Gill, Colorado, after the Colorado Water Conservation Board approved a weather modification permit on November 11, 2025. The permit is valid through October 31, 2026 with a potential five-year renewal. The solar-powered, chemical-free WETA can cover up to 360 square miles (≈230,000 acres) in Weld County and cites peer-reviewed trials indicating potential rainfall increases of 15–18%. The system will operate under strict oversight with real-time monitoring, automatic suspension during National Weather Service severe-weather warnings, and annual target-control evaluations and reporting requirements.

Company’s WETA Ionization Technology Begins Operations in Gill, Colorado, Marking State’s First Warm Weather Modification Program

Advertisement

NAPLES, FL / ACCESS Newswire / November 11, 2025 / Rain Enhancement Technologies Holdco, Inc. (NASDAQ:RAIN) (“RAIN” or the “Company”), a leading provider of ionization rainfall generation technology, today announced it has commenced operations of its first U.S. installation following approval of a Weather Modification Permit from the State of Colorado’s Water Conservation Board. The Company’s Weather Enhancement Technology Array (WETA) system, installed in Gill, Colorado, in October 2025, marks the state’s first warm weather modification program and is now operational under a permit valid through October 31, 2026, with the potential for a five-year renewal. The installation can enhance up to 360 square miles of agricultural land in Weld County, where the technology has the potential to increase rainfall by 15-18% based on peer-reviewed trials.

“This first U.S. installation represents a transformative milestone for Rain Enhancement Technologies as we bring our proven ionization technology to American agricultural communities,” said Randy Seidl, CEO of Rain Enhancement Technologies. “Colorado’s rigorous evaluation process and forward-thinking approach to water resource management validate the potential of our technology to address water scarcity challenges. We’re proud to pioneer the state’s first warm weather modification program at a time when innovative water solutions are critically needed.”

The ground-based WETA system operates by using electrical charge to create naturally occurring ionized aerosols, which then travel to cloud layers where they enhance condensation and stimulate precipitation. Unlike Colorado’s traditional cold weather cloud seeding that uses silver iodide, RAIN’s chemical-free, solar-powered approach harnesses natural atmospheric processes.

“After years of working with this groundbreaking technology internationally, it’s very exciting to see the growing interest in our solution to address the ongoing water shortage crisis,” said Scott Morris, Chief Technical Officer of Rain Enhancement Technologies. “With the first of our US installations to be deployed, we’re excited to demonstrate the real-world impact of ionization rainfall generation technology at scale. The Gill installation represents years of engineering refinement and will operate autonomously using solar power, making it both environmentally sustainable and cost-effective.”

This marks Colorado’s first warm weather seeding operation, differentiating it from existing cold weather programs in the state that use silver iodide to enhance snowpack. RAIN’s ionization technology has demonstrated effectiveness in warm weather conditions through international deployments, including a six-year trial in Oman’s Hajar Mountains, where results were published by the Royal Statistical Society showing statistically significant rainfall increases. The Colorado installation operates under strict regulatory oversight, including automatic suspension protocols during National Weather Service severe weather warnings, real-time weather monitoring capabilities, and coordination with local emergency management officials.

Advertisement

“We’re encouraged by the potential of this innovative technology to supplement water resources for Colorado’s agricultural communities,” said Andrew Rickert, Weather Modification Program Manager with the Colorado Water Conservation Board. “This program will provide valuable data on warm weather modification effectiveness while maintaining our rigorous safety and environmental standards. Rain Enhancement Technologies’ approach represents a new tool in our comprehensive water management strategy.”

The Colorado installation comes as western U.S. agriculture faces persistent drought conditions that have forced farmers to fallow fields, reduce livestock herds, and seek innovative water security solutions. Colorado’s agricultural sector, which consumes approximately 80% of the state’s developed water supply, continues to experience pressure from reduced water allocations and climate variability. The WETA system’s coverage area can enhance up to 360 square miles, encompassing 230,000 acres of agricultural land that could benefit from enhanced precipitation.

As part of the permit requirements, RAIN will conduct annual target-control evaluations, submit periodic performance reports to project sponsors, and provide detailed annual reports to the Colorado Water Conservation Board. The solar-powered system operates autonomously with minimal maintenance requirements and produces no environmental residue through its chemical-free ionization process.
